Could this cover it?

Uniform Code of Military Justice, Sec. 888, Article 88.....

"Any commissioned officer who uses contemptiuous words against the President, the Vice President (And a long list of other elected officals) in which he is on duty or present shall be punished as a court-martial may direct."

Popularity has nothing to do with it. If you feel you cannot serve the Commander in Chief you should take steps toward retirement. This General can be replaced in seconds. Anybody can. Our Military is set up to deal with this and has been for many, many years.
